UI换皮实战技巧与详细步骤教程

版权申诉
5星 · 超过95%的资源 1 下载量 16 浏览量 更新于2024-10-05 收藏 5.36MB ZIP 举报
资源摘要信息: "UI换皮详细教程" 知识点概述: UI换皮是指在已有的软件、应用程序或游戏界面中更换其视觉元素,以达到改变视觉效果而不改变功能和结构的目的。该教程主要针对游戏UI的设计与修改,但其概念和技术同样适用于其他类型的UI设计。以下是详细的知识点分解。 1. UI换皮的目的和意义 UI换皮可以帮助开发者迅速更新产品的外观,提升用户体验。此外,通过换皮可以轻松地进行品牌调整或者适应不同市场的需求。对于游戏产品来说,随着版本更新或节日活动,更换UI界面可以使游戏显得更加新鲜,吸引玩家。 2. UI设计基础知识 在进行UI换皮前,需要掌握UI设计的基础知识。这包括色彩学、排版、布局、图标设计、交互逻辑等。了解这些知识有助于设计出既美观又实用的UI元素。 3. 素材准备和工具使用 更换UI元素需要准备相关的素材,例如新的图标、按钮、背景图等。同时,需要熟悉使用UI设计与开发的工具,如Photoshop、Illustrator、Sketch等设计工具,以及可能涉及的代码编辑器,如Sublime Text、Visual Studio Code等。 4. 分析原有UI结构 在进行换皮之前,必须深入分析原有的UI结构和代码逻辑,以便在更换视觉元素时不破坏原有的功能。这通常涉及到对原应用程序或游戏的源代码进行审查。 5. 设计新UI元素 根据游戏或应用的风格,设计新的UI元素。这可能包括制作新的皮肤、按钮、图标、字体、窗口布局等。设计过程中要注意元素的可辨识度、色彩搭配以及整体的美观性。 6. UI元素替换方法 介绍如何在不改变功能的前提下,通过修改图像资源、编辑XML文件或直接修改源代码等方法来替换UI元素。这需要对软件或游戏的资源管理有深刻的理解。 7. 兼容性和测试 在换皮过程中要注意兼容性问题,确保新的UI元素在不同分辨率和设备上均能正常显示。完成更换后,需要进行严格的测试,包括功能测试、用户体验测试和性能测试,以确保换皮后的UI既美观又实用。 8. 跨平台UI换皮注意事项 如果软件或游戏需要支持多个平台,那么在换皮时需要注意各平台间的差异性,比如不同操作系统对UI元素的渲染效果可能不同。此外,还需考虑不同平台的用户习惯和界面规范。 9. 法律和版权问题 在进行UI换皮时,要注意遵循相关的法律和版权规定,确保所有使用的素材均为合法授权。避免侵犯原设计者的版权,以及可能引发的法律诉讼。 10. 案例分析 通过对一些成功的UI换皮案例进行分析,了解这些案例是如何在保持原有功能的同时,改善界面美观性和用户体验的。分析过程中可以学习到一些实用的技巧和方法。 通过以上知识点的详细解释,读者将获得UI换皮的全面认识,从理论到实践,从设计到实现,全面掌握UI换皮的技能。这将帮助开发者或设计师提升自身专业能力,为用户打造更加个性化和吸引力的产品界面。